Transaction fe667ccf593a93fdfae77b447cac1cab388f5a4f9df6aabca8c1d9f769943ca4

1 Input
2 Outputs
  • fe667ccf593a93fdfae77b447cac1cab388f5a4f9df6aabca8c1d9f769943ca4:0
  • value  370290933
    address  3R1rcYxmkDuPuWz7p1kJmYhq7Xgh5XL7mY
  • fe667ccf593a93fdfae77b447cac1cab388f5a4f9df6aabca8c1d9f769943ca4:1
  • value  39000000
    address  14PBkWULrJzQVH4kdVFonhHeiDCXmSxC4R